NOTE: A connection to 1 Gb/s network is strongly
recommended.
Standard pre-made CAT-5e or higher (CAT-6 etc) network
cables (see note hereafter) may be used to connect
amplifiers to the local Ethernet switch(es). However, in
many installations, the network connection from within a
rack to an Ethernet switch will be via structural cabling. In
this case, wire mating RJ-45 plugs (not supplied) as shown
below:

The maximum cable run for reliable operation using
CAT-5e cable is of the order of 100 m. If longer distances
are involved, the use of multimode fibre-optic cable is
recommended. This is generally satisfactory up to 2 km,
but repeaters (or the use of single-mode fibre) can be used
to increase the distance further. A third-party Ethernet-to-
fibre interface will be required in these situations.

NOTE: Unscreened CAT-5e UTP cable can be
used, but note that the amplifier may fail to
preserve its high level of surge immunity and as a
consequence, will no longer be compliant with the
standards set out in the EC Statement of Conformity.
CAT-5e twisted pair cable with an overall foil shield
(referred to as FTP or F/UTP) is required for compliancy.

ANS microphone input

The IndustryAmp's DSP card includes an Autogain
algorithm which adjusts the gain of the amplifier in
response to ambient noise levels. To accomplish this, an
external Ambient Noise Sensing (ANS) microphone must
be connected to the ANS mic input.
Connection is via a 3-pin 3.81 mm-pitch screw terminal
connector, with the same pinout as the analogue audio
inputs. See "fig.2: Analogue Inputs" on page 12 for
wiring details.
